Product Description

The Alive Grad Type 1 Frame was designed by company founder Yogo Ito and it quickly became the team frame. It's a simple design that has a throwback feel to those mid school BMX frames.

Full chromoly construction paired with a thin tube set downtube gusset keeps the Grad Frame strong and durable, with enough space to run a 33T sprocket and room for 2.35" tyres.

This Grad Type 1 Frame model is brakeless.

Product Specs
  1. MATERIAL: 100% Chromoly
  2. HEAD TUBE ANGLE: 74.5°
  3. SEAT TUBE ANGLE: 71°
  4. CHAIN STAY LENGTH: 13.6" - 13.85"
  5. BB HEIGHT: 11.625"
  6. WHEEL SIZE: 20"
  7. STANDOVER HEIGHT: 9.25"
  8. DROPOUT SIZE: 14mm
  9. HEADSET TYPE: Integrated
  10. BB TYPE: Mid
  11. BRAKE MOUNTS: Brakeless
  12. GYRO TABS: Removable (Sold separately)
  13. WEIGHT: 5.04lbs (2.32kg)

FRAME SIZE CHART

Frame sizing is very much a personal preference: some riders like them longer, others shorter. Here's a rough guide - if you have any questions remember we are here to help!

3ft - 3ft 8" - best suited to a 16" BMX bike
3ft 8" - 4ft - best suited an 18" BMX bike
4ft - 5ft - 18" to 20" top tube
5ft - 5ft 4" - 20" to 20.25" top tube
5ft 4" - 5ft 8" - 20.25" to 21" top tube
5ft 8" - 6ft - 21" to 21.25" top tube
6ft plus - 21" top tube or longer

FRAME GEOMETRY

Frame geometry can take a bit of understanding - but here at SourceBMX we are here to help! The first thing to understand is that BMX frame sizing is best measured by the length of the top tube - shown here as TT. Keep reading on to understand how the angles change how your frame will feel!
